Practical Strategies to Accelerate Your Leadership Journey
Now, let’s dive into some actionable strategies that can help you grow as an executive leader. These approaches are designed to be practical and adaptable, so you can integrate them into your busy schedule.
1. Seek Feedback Regularly
Feedback is a powerful tool for growth. Encourage your peers, mentors, and team members to share honest insights about your leadership style. Use this feedback to identify blind spots and areas for improvement. For example, you might discover that your communication style could be more inclusive or that you need to delegate more effectively.
2. Invest in Continuous Learning
Leadership trends and challenges evolve rapidly. Commit to ongoing education through workshops, webinars, books, and coaching. Consider enrolling in leadership development programs tailored for executives. These programs often provide valuable frameworks and peer learning opportunities that can accelerate your growth.
3. Build a Strong Support Network
Surround yourself with a diverse group of trusted advisors and fellow leaders. This network can offer guidance, encouragement, and fresh perspectives. Don’t hesitate to reach out for advice or to share your own experiences. Leadership is not a solo journey; it thrives on connection.
4. Practice Mindful Leadership
Mindfulness helps you stay present, manage stress, and make thoughtful decisions. Incorporate mindfulness techniques such as meditation, journaling, or deep breathing into your daily routine. This practice can enhance your emotional intelligence and resilience, which are critical for effective leadership.
5. Set Clear, Measurable Goals
Define specific leadership goals that align with your personal values and organizational objectives. Break these goals into manageable steps and track your progress. For instance, if you want to improve team engagement, set targets for regular one-on-one meetings or team-building activities.

Cultivating a Growth Mindset for Lasting Impact
A growth mindset is the belief that abilities and intelligence can be developed through dedication and hard work. This mindset is essential for executive leadership growth because it encourages resilience and adaptability.
To cultivate a growth mindset:
Embrace challenges as opportunities to learn rather than obstacles.
View failures as valuable feedback, not as reflections of your worth.
Celebrate effort and progress, not just outcomes.
Encourage curiosity by asking questions and seeking new experiences.
By adopting this mindset, you create a culture of continuous improvement within yourself and your organization. This approach not only benefits your leadership but also inspires your team to grow alongside you.
Leveraging Coaching and Mentoring for Executive Success
One of the most effective ways to enhance your leadership skills is through coaching and mentoring. A skilled coach can help you uncover hidden strengths, overcome limiting beliefs, and develop new strategies tailored to your unique challenges.
Mentoring, on the other hand, provides a long-term relationship where you can gain wisdom from someone who has walked a similar path. Both coaching and mentoring offer personalized support that accelerates your leadership development.

Inspiring Others Through Authentic Leadership
True leadership is about inspiring others to be their best selves. Authenticity is the foundation of this inspiration. When you lead with honesty, vulnerability, and integrity, you build trust and loyalty.
Here are some ways to practice authentic leadership:
Share your story and values openly.
Admit mistakes and learn from them.
Listen actively and show empathy.
Recognize and celebrate the contributions of others.
By embodying these qualities, you create a positive ripple effect that elevates your entire organization. Remember, your leadership legacy is shaped not just by what you achieve but by how you uplift those around you.
